From mboxrd@z Thu Jan 1 00:00:00 1970 From: Lisa & Eric Malkowski Subject: IBM xSeries 360 4 x Xeon kernel 2.2 problems Date: Sun, 11 Aug 2002 21:29:51 -0400 Sender: linux-smp-owner@vger.kernel.org Message-ID: <3D570F8E.B0B8EE96@charter.net> Mime-Version: 1.0 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 7bit Return-path: List-Id: Content-Type: text/plain; charset="us-ascii" To: linux-smp@vger.kernel.org Cc: Eric_Malkowski@adc.com, malk@charter.net Hi- There was an e-mail thread back in march where someone had trouble running kernel 2.2.21 SMP on an IBM xSeries 360 w/ 4 processors in it. I'm trying to get 2.2 running on one of these as we are currently dependent on 2.2. A UP 2.2 kernel runs just fine. I've tried SMP 2.2.21 and 2.2.21-rc4 and get the same results. It behaves as if interrupts just aren't occurring at all. Apparently an APIC table isn't being parsed properly -- the boot messages below can help confirm this. Any 2.4 kernel seems to run just fine on this system -- so the hardware should be OK. Does anyone know of any solution to this?? or forgive me if I missed an already known solution out there -- I've scoured the web and IBM pretty well and only found the earlier thread from march 2002 timeframe.
